Resumen:
In a nonlinear system a singular crossing point is a singular point such that there is at least one solution crossing through it. In this article we study a family of nonlinear electrical circuits, that can be represented by nonlinear Implicit Differential Equations -IDEs-. We set conditions that ensure the existence of singular crossing points in these circuits. There are different approachs to this problem for a given general IDE, but the results we get for this family of circuits allow us to find these points in an extremely simple way. The results are illustrated in a concrete example.
